BetaTrader
A HFT Eco-System
Loading...
Searching...
No Matches
trading_core::Partition Member List

This is the complete list of members for trading_core::Partition, including all inherited members.

enqueue(std::unique_ptr< Command > command)trading_core::Partition
getDatabaseWorker() consttrading_core::Partition
getMatcher() consttrading_core::Partition
getOrderBook() consttrading_core::Partition
getOrderManager() consttrading_core::Partition
getOrderRepository() consttrading_core::Partition
getQueueSize() consttrading_core::Partition
getRiskManager() consttrading_core::Partition
getSymbol() consttrading_core::Partition
getTradeIDGenerator() consttrading_core::Partition
getWorker() consttrading_core::Partition
init()trading_core::Partitionprivate
mAcceptingCommandstrading_core::Partitionprivate
mCommandQueuetrading_core::Partitionprivate
mDatabaseWorkertrading_core::Partitionprivate
mMatchertrading_core::Partitionprivate
mOrderBooktrading_core::Partitionprivate
mOrderManagertrading_core::Partitionprivate
mOrderRepositorytrading_core::Partitionprivate
mPublishertrading_core::Partitionprivate
mReadyFuturetrading_core::Partitionprivate
mRiskManagertrading_core::Partitionprivate
mSymboltrading_core::Partitionprivate
mTradeIDGeneratortrading_core::Partitionprivate
mTradeRepositorytrading_core::Partitionprivate
mWorkertrading_core::Partitionprivate
Partition(common::Instrument symbol, data::DatabaseWorker *databaseWorker, TradeIDGenerator *tradeIDGenerator, MarketDataPublisher &publisher)trading_core::Partition
Partition(common::Instrument symbol, data::DatabaseWorker *databaseWorker, TradeIDGenerator *tradeIDGenerator, MarketDataPublisher &publisher, std::unique_ptr< data::TradeRepository > tradeRepository, std::unique_ptr< data::OrderRepository > orderRepository, std::unique_ptr< OrderManager > orderManager, std::unique_ptr< OrderBook > orderBook, std::unique_ptr< Matcher > matcher, std::unique_ptr< RiskManager > riskManager)trading_core::Partition
start()trading_core::Partition
stop()trading_core::Partition
stopAcceptingCommands()trading_core::Partition
waitReady()trading_core::Partition
~Partition()trading_core::Partition